For persons with HIV/AIDS who also battle with a substance abuse problem, their pre-existing continuing medical condition is something that will need to be acknowledged and adequately addressed simultaneously while they receive rehabilitation for their drug/alcohol addiction. Getting this client in treatment is not only central for their well-being, but for the safety of the general public due to the fact they may spread their disease to others if their drug or alcohol problem continue or worsen.

In many cases, clients who fight with both HIV/AIDS and addiction at the same time may have let their health fall apart due to the lack of care most people with addictions give themselves even when they are without HIV or AIDS. Some quit taking their medication, stop seeking medical care, etc. and therefore need serious medical intervention once they receive drug or alcohol addiction treatment. Aside from treatment for their drug addiction, in a rehabilitation center which provides treatment for individuals with HIV or AIDS, clients will get a full medical assessment to see if they are experiencing any other illnesses associated with their disease. This would include screening for Hepatitis A, B, and C, tuberculosis, other sexually transmitted diseases, dental issues, diabetes and mental health disorders.

Drug or alcohol abuse rehab for persons with HIV/AIDS in Alicia would include detox treatment that are responsibly conducted with both the client and the staff in mind. Through counseling, psychotherapy and holistic services persons with HIV or AIDS become motivated to be sober and healthier, and attending recovery meetings where other individuals have the same sober goal is strongly encouraged.
